Create and validate piping stress models using CAESAR II for new and modified piping systems.
Perform stress analysis for thermal cycles, seismic loads, wind loads, support settlement, and relief valve actions.
Assess stresses, displacements, forces, and moments on restraints; verify piping loads against allowable limits.
Calculate nozzle flexibilities and perform flange leak-check assessments.
Select and specify spring hangers, expansion joints, and other supports; prepare related datasheets.
Maintain stress analysis reports and critical line lists.
Coordinate with layout and 3D modelling teams to resolve design clashes and routing issues.
Support continuous improvement of pipe support standards and practices.
Bachelors degree in Mechanical Engineering.
Minimum 7 years of proven experience in piping stress engineering.
Hands-on expertise in CAESAR II and piping stress analysis.
Knowledge of piping codes and standards (ASME, API, and other relevant standards).
Ability to interpret GA drawings, isometrics, MTO, support drawings, material specs, and line lists.
Experience in selection and specification of pipe supports, spring hangers, and expansion joints.
